You do not plug a CMB24D into a CTB16PC. The CMB24D is its own standalone DC controller. All you need is a DC power supply & enclosure.

Power calculations are different for everyone. It will depend on the strips you are using. Power requirements vary wildly from strip to strip.

The CTB16PC is 120v AC and the CMB24D is 5-30v DC and they can't plug into each other electrical wise.  They will connect together via cat5 cable for data transfer only but other then that they are two separate controllers.

Lets define the CMB24D. Its a DC controller which is designed to work with "dumb" led strips. Typically these run off 12vdc. You would need a 12vdc power supply to power the CMB24D and the strips attached to it. "dumb" strips are just that...the entire strip changes to any color you wish, based upon the sequencing you apply. The controller supplies +12V on one wire. The other 3 wires, R, G, B are Red, Green and Blue respectively. To each of those, the controller will supply or vary -12V in whatever combination to create the desired color. Its commanded from the LOR RS485 comm buss.

You need to work out how many strips can be connected based on how much power they use (How many LEDs in every meter, how much does each of these use?), the limitations of the CMB24D and your power supply.
